Lädt ... German Social Democracy (1896)18 | Keine | 1,191,321 | Keine | Keine | "This is Bertrand Russell's first book (it was published in 1896). Its purpose then was to provide a convenient introduction to German Social Democracy - its history, its goals, its tactics, and the influence upon it of such thinkers as Marx, Engels and Lassalle." "Since that time, much has changed. But the book remains an important historical document, precisely because it does represent the views of an orthodox Liberal of the period. As Bertrand Russell was to say later in his life, in it "a former writer comments on a former world"." "German Social Democracy is a vital document for students of European history, and for all those who read and admire the works of Bertrand Russell."--BOOK JACKET.Title Summary field provided by Blackwell North America, Inc.
